What Is Pediatric Dentistry?

Pediatric dentistry is dedicated to children’s oral health from infancy through adolescence. Kids have unique dental needs, and our team tailors every visit to meet those needs with patience, kindness, and the latest modern dentistry tools.

We perform regular checkups, cleanings, fluoride treatments, dental sealants, and cavity detection. We also monitor the development of your child’s teeth, jaws, and bite alignment. If issues arise, we treat them promptly and gently.

Every child’s visit includes thorough education—for both the child and parents—on brushing, flossing, and nutritional choices that impact dental health.

Preparing for Your Child’s First Visit

We encourage you to bring your child for their first dental visit by their first birthday or when their first tooth appears. Here’s how to get ready:

  • Talk positively about the dentist. Avoid using words like “hurt” or “pain.”
  • Bring comfort items. A favorite stuffed animal or blanket can help your child feel at ease.
  • Complete any forms ahead of time. This shortens wait time and reduces stress.
  • Write down any questions or concerns. We’re happy to address everything during your visit.

Healthy Habits Start Early

Strong oral health habits begin at home. Between dental visits, help your child keep their teeth healthy with these simple steps:

  • Brush twice a day using a soft-bristled toothbrush and fluoride toothpaste.
  • Help or supervise brushing until your child can tie their shoes—usually around age 6-7.
  • Floss daily once teeth touch.
  • Avoid sugary snacks and drinks. Offer water and tooth-friendly foods instead.
  • Use a mouthguard for sports and activities that risk dental injury.
  • Lead by example. Let your child see you brushing, flossing, and attending regular dental visits.
